Bujinkan Kuriru Dj 10.10.2021

Since many of you have been asking... Yes, it is true that Hatsumi-sensei will no longer be holding trainings at the Tokyo Budkan in Ayase. Going forward, Tuesday night classes will be held in Honbu Dj at the usual time. I know that everyone will miss the extra space that Ayase provided for training. All the same, we have a wonderful new Honbu Dj and so we can now enjoy getting even more use out of it with all of Ske's classes being held there.
